ANSARI ORAL ORDER 16-07-2015 This is an application, made under Section 438 of the Code of Criminal Procedure, seeking pre-arrest bail by the petitioner, namely, Kiran Devi @ Kiran Kumari, in connection with Khizar Sarai Police Station Case No. 248 of 2014 under Section 302 read with Section 34 of the Indian Penal Code. Perused the above application and materials on record including a copy of the order, dated 04.03.2015, passed, in A.B.P. No. 225 of 2015, by the learned Sessions Judge, Gaya, dismissing the said application for pre-arrest bail. Heard Mr. Manish Kumar No.2, learned Counsel for the petitioner, and Mrs. Pushpa Sinha, learned Additional Public Prosecutor, appearing on behalf of the State. In view of the fact that perusal of record does not reveal any such incriminating materials against the petitioner,
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.14813 of 2015 (6) dt.16-07-2015 2/3 which would warrant her custodial detention and interrogation, this Court is of the view that the petitioner has been able to make out a case calling for appropriate direction for pre-arrest bail. Considering, therefore, the matter in its entirety and in the interest of justice, it is hereby directed that the petitioner above-named shall, in the event of her arrest in connection with the case aforementioned, be released on bail of Rs. 10,000/-, with two sureties, each of the like amount, subject to the satisfaction of the Officer-in-Charge, Khizar Sarai Police Station, Gaya.
This direction for bail is further subject to the condition that the petitioner above-named shall, within two weeks from today, appear before the Officer-in-Charge, Khizar Sarai Police Station, Gaya, and make herself available for interrogation by police at all reasonable time and shall not, directly or indirectly, make any inducement, threat or promise to any person acquainted with the facts of the case so as to dissuade them from disclosing such facts to the Court or to any police officer.
This application for pre-arrest bail shall stand disposed of in terms of the above observations and directions. Let a copy of this order be sent, forthwith, to the Officer-in-Charge, Khizar Sarai Police Station, Gaya. Send also a copy of this order, forthwith, to the
